WebHowever, aggressive handling can result in the injury or death of rodents. A balance of an assertive yet gentle approach is the goal for rodent handling. Mice and small rats can be restrained by grasping the skin at the nape of the neck, referred to as scruffing. Precautions for this method include both grasping the skin too firmly or too loosely.
